from flask import Flask
from flask import request
import os
import requests
import socket
import sys
app = Flask(__name__)
TRACE_HEADERS_TO_PROPAGATE = [
'X-Ot-Span-Context',
'X-Request-Id',
# Zipkin headers
'X-B3-TraceId',
'X-B3-SpanId',
'X-B3-ParentSpanId',
'X-B3-Sampled',
'X-B3-Flags',
# Jaeger header (for native client)
"uber-trace-id"
]
@app.route('/service/<service_number>')
def hello(service_number):
return ('Hello from behind Envoy (service {})! hostname: {} resolved'
'hostname: {}\n'.format(os.environ['SERVICE_NAME'], socket.gethostname(),
socket.gethostbyname(socket.gethostname())))
@app.route('/trace/<service_number>')
def trace(service_number):
headers = {}
# call service 2 from service 1
if int(os.environ['SERVICE_NAME']) == 1:
for header in TRACE_HEADERS_TO_PROPAGATE:
if header in request.headers:
headers[header] = request.headers[header]
ret = requests.get("http://localhost:9000/trace/2", headers=headers)
return ('Hello from behind Envoy (service {})! hostname: {} resolved'
'hostname: {}\n'.format(os.environ['SERVICE_NAME'], socket.gethostname(),
socket.gethostbyname(socket.gethostname())))
if __name__ == "__main__":
app.run(host='127.0.0.1', port=8080, debug=True)
